Young puppies need to be vaccinated
If you have a puppy, it is essential that they are updated on all their inoculations. This will certainly help them connect safely with other canines and people. A veterinarian can figure out the most effective vaccination timetable for puppies. Vaccinations are typically given in two to four-week intervals up until your pup is 16 weeks old. Along with a thorough exam, your puppy will receive several injections.
Core puppy shots/vaccinations include DAPPv, which safeguards against canine distemper, adenovirus (hepatitis), parvovirus, and parainfluenza; and the rabies vaccine, which avoids the potentially fatal rabies virus. The rabies vaccine is legally required in many states. In addition, non-core puppy vaccines can include the lyme disease vaccine, leptospirosis vaccine, and Bordetella, which protects against kennel coughing. The last is advised for pups and pet dogs that check out pet dog parks, groomers, travel, or be boarded. It is likewise useful to attend a veterinary-approved puppy socialization course throughout this moment. This will certainly enable your pup to have fun with various other vaccinated canines and humans in regulated atmospheres.
Young puppies ought to be socialized
Young puppy day care offers a structured environment for your pet to shed energy and interact socially. It additionally offers young puppies the opportunity to find out exactly how to communicate safely with individuals and other pets, which is essential for their growth. Puppy day care can also assist with basic training, such as potty training and chain walking.
Throughout young puppy socialization classes, your pup will be exposed to other pups of different breeds, ages, and sizes as well as people and youngsters. They will certainly be permitted to interact with them briefly yet not for prolonged amount of times. Young puppy classes may additionally subject your puppy to brand-new things, such as skateboards, wheelchairs, going shopping carts, bikes, and cages; and seems like vacuum, music, and sounds from the kitchen area or veterinary workplaces.
Nonetheless, it is essential to remember that pups are not implied to encounter many people and areas at one time. This can be overwhelming and create them to establish afraid responses as grownups.
